Place the following sentences into the cycle diagram below to outline the steps of translation. i. The ribosome pulls the mRNA strand the length of one codon. The first tRNA exits the ribosome, and another codon is exposed. ii. The ribosome forms a peptide bond between the amino acids. It breaks the between the first amino acid and tRNA. iii. An exposed codon attracts a complementary tRNA bearing an amino acid. A. Ribosome assembles at the start codon of mRNA strand. C. B. When the ribosome encounters a stop codon, it falls apart and the protein is released. bond New World American PVT School مدرسة العالم الجديد األمريكية الخاصة Name:..........................................................................................
